Kuwait : Perampally Welfare Association – Kuwait (PWA) celebrated the Nativity of our Blessed Virgin Mary “Monthi Fest” at Indian Public School Auditorium, Salmiya on Friday, September 29, under the leadership of President Arun D’Souza.
More than 160 devotees had gathered to celebrate the “Monthi Fest”. Prayer to worship our Blessed Mother Mary was led by Edna Dsouza. Group of children offered flowers, Youngsters and Adults offered Candles, Novem, various kinds of vegetables & Sugarcane, while all who were gathered sang hymns ‘Sakkad Sangatha Mellyan’ and ‘Moriyek Hogolsian’ in honour of Mother Mary
The program was compered by Melwyn Mascarenhas who took charge of the entire proceedings with grace.
The guest for the event was Norbert D’Souza (Vice President of Abbasiya Parish Council). The guests were felicitated with flower bouquets. A warm welcome was addressed to the gathering by Arun Dsouza. A brief annual report was presented by Secretary Edna Dsouza and message from Fr. Romeo Lewis was read by Roshan Dsouza.
The cultural program proceeded with great enthusiasm and entertainment shown by various performers.
The entertainment was filled with music, dance and singing. Dance show performed by Roslyn, Royce, Larissa, Ronalda, Sanya, Realene & Nishmita. Goan folk dance choreographed by Nelson Dsilva was performed by PWA team lead by Nelson, Reshma, Ronald, Nirmala, Fredrick and Josyln. Fusion Dance Group, Kuwait entertained with their South Indian Dance style.
Solo singing by the famous singer and winner of Gulf Voice of Mangalore - 2014, Morvin Quadros was a special attraction of the event. Konkani comedy skit was presented by famous Konkani artists, Lionel Rayan Ajekar and Rajesh Fernandes and supported by member Helen Dsouza.
Various spot prizes were conducted by Melwyn Mascarenhas. Sumit Dsouza & Arun Dsouza thanked the people for their contribution and continuous support towards the cause and felicitated all the contributors. Yet another special attraction of the event was the Kombo draw (Live cock). Many members sponsored for this event by means of Vegetables, flowers and sugarcane etc., auctioned for raising funds for the new church building. Raffle ticket draw conducted and prizes were distributed by Lionel Ajekar and Rajesh Fernandes along with PWA members.
Urban Dsouza offered prayer before meals. Traditional food (Novem Jevaan) was served during the occasion by M & M confectionery. Delicious fish preparation was also served which was prepared by Rocky Dsouza & family. The beautiful stage and Mother Mary Grotto set and decorated lead by Sunil Dsouza and Ajith Dsouza. The programme concluded with grand baila by DJ Bosco Dsouza. The whole event was captured by photographer Prem Crasto.
